How Our Temperature-Controlled Drying Process Works
When you call our team for Temperature-Controlled Drying you can expect a thorough and effective process that reduces damage to your property. Our crew will arrive quickly, assess the situation, and begin the drying process using state-of-the-art equipment. This ensures that your home is safe and dry in no time.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will arrive to assess the situation and create a customized drying plan to meet your specific needs. This ensures that we’re using the right equipment and techniques to get the job done efficiently.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using specialized equipment, we’ll remove any standing water from your property, including water from carpets water from upholstery and water from hardwood floors.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use powerful drying equipment to remove any remaining moisture from your property, including air dryers and dehumidifiers. This ensures that your home is completely dry and free of water damage.
Step 4: Sanitation and Disinfection
We’ll thoroughly -sanitize and disinfect your property to prevent any mold growth or bacterial contamination. This ensures that your home is safe and healthy for you and your loved ones.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Follow-up
Once the drying process is complete, we’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ure that your home is completely dry and free of any water damage. We’ll also provide follow-up care to ensure that any lingering issues are addressed.

Warning Signs You Need Temperature-Controlled Drying
Don’t wait until it’s too late, catch these warning signs early and prevent costly water damage in your home.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ice musty odors in your home that won’t go away, it’s a sign of mold growth. This can lead to serious health issues and costly repairs.
Water Stains or Warping on Walls or Floors
Water stains or warping on your walls or floors can show water damage that needs to be addressed quickly.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or mold growth that needs to be addressed quickly.
Unpleasant Moisture or Humidity
Unpleasant moisture or humidity in your home can lead to mold growth and water damage if not addressed quickly.
Visible Signs of Water Damage
Visible signs of water damage, such as buckling floors or water marks need immediate attention to prevent costly repairs.

Temperature-Controlled Drying Cost in Carney, MD
The cost of Temperature-Controlled Drying in Carney, MD can vary depending on the severity of the water dam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a customized estimate based on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Sanitation and Disinfection |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of disinfection needed |
| Final Inspection and Follow-up | $500 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of follow-up care needed |
| Emergency Service Fee | $200 – $500 | Time of day, day of week, severity of situation |
| More Equipment or Materials | $500 – $2,000 | Type of equipment or materials needed |
